Output 507f75099d207f84979bf666f9383dae929baab1657ec8b4c7a10e0c22739f84:0

value
40808367
script pubkey
OP_0 OP_PUSHBYTES_20 efca884c4a835e01b9fded3553552cf8d21598d0
address
ltc1qal9gsnz2sd0qrw0aa564x4fvlrfptxxs2utjne
transaction
507f75099d207f84979bf666f9383dae929baab1657ec8b4c7a10e0c22739f84
spent
true